ISKCON Bangalore, also known as the Sri Radha Krishna Temple, is one of the largest and most visited ISKCON temples in the world. Located on Hare Krishna Hill in Rajajinagar, this iconic temple is a blend of spirituality, culture, and modern architecture. It was inaugurated in 1997 and is managed by the International Society for Krishna Consciousness (ISKCON), dedicated to spreading the teachings of Lord Krishna and the Bhagavad Gita.
The temple complex spans over 7 acres and features a harmonious fusion of traditional South Indian temple design with contemporary elements. The towering gopuram (ornamental tower), intricately carved interiors, and beautifully adorned deities of Sri Radha Krishna, Sri Nitai Gauranga, Sri Prahlada Narasimha, and Sri Srinivasa Govinda offer a divine experience to devotees and visitors alike.
ISKCON Bangalore is more than a temple—it’s a vibrant cultural and spiritual hub. Daily rituals include multiple aartis, bhajans, and spiritual discourses, while festivals such as Janmashtami, Rama Navami, and Radhashtami are celebrated with grandeur, drawing thousands of devotees. The temple also features the Akshaya Patra Foundation headquarters, one of the world’s largest mid-day meal programs serving millions of school children across India.
The temple premises include a Vedic museum, a book and gift shop, a pure vegetarian restaurant (Higher Taste), and ample open space for meditation and peaceful walks. Special programs like Bhagavad Gita classes, youth outreach, and cultural workshops are regularly conducted, making it a center for holistic spiritual development.
